Output 1686ed76f74ea6fb59ab9af47f9631ffb65995955f378eb5a8d54db2138b3295:0

value
587475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345b067c8f04e21b3e158a557518a0695850190c OP_EQUAL
address
36Tr752kwSvdmM9vgMqLRDk6EQSL5DFqb5
transaction
1686ed76f74ea6fb59ab9af47f9631ffb65995955f378eb5a8d54db2138b3295
confirmations
196468
spent
true